As a Security Architect, you'll partner with government, financial services, and private sector clients to design security solutions that address their most complex digital risks. You'll translate threat landscapes, compliance obligations, and business constraints into practical security architectures, working across the full engagement lifecycle from threat modelling, security options analysis, through to facilitating design sessions with delivery teams and presenting recommendations to architecture review boards and senior stakeholders.
Whether that's defining a zero‑trust approach for a government department, designing security controls for a bank's cloud migration, or guiding development teams through secure‑by‑design decisions, you'll bring both depth and pragmatism. Your background in cloud security, application security, and public sector compliance means clients can trust your advice on what works in enterprise environments.
You’ll join our central architecture practice alongside experienced Technology Principals and Solution Architects. Security in delivery teams is often under‑served; your role is to change that, not through gates and sign‑offs, but by embedding security thinking early and keeping it there. That includes guiding and upskilling delivery teams on secure‑by‑design practices, helping engineers and product managers build security literacy without slowing down delivery.
